Claims
- 1. A coding apparatus comprising:a) input means for inputting an image signal; b) coding means for coding the image signal input by said input means, said coding means for adaptively executing a first coding mode for performing intra-picture coding and a second coding mode for performing inter-picture coding, said coding means for selecting the coding mode on a unit of a predetermined data amount of the image signal and forcibly selecting the first coding mode at first predetermined time intervals so that the second coding mode is prevented from being executed continuously during each first predetermined time interval; and c) change means for changing the length of each first predetermined time interval to cause said coding means to select the first coding mode at second predetermined time intervals.
- 2. An apparatus according to claim 1, wherein said change means changes the length of each first predetermined interval according to a quantity of coded data of the image signal.
- 3. An apparatus according to claim 1, further comprisinga buffer memory for temporarily storing the coded data to be read out at a predetermined transmission rate.
- 4. An apparatus according to claim 3, whereinthe quantity of coded data generated is determined by a data occupation quantity of said buffer memory.
- 5. An apparatus according to claim 3, whereinsaid coding means includes quantization means for quantizing the image signal input by said input means.
- 6. An apparatus according to claim 5, further comprisingcontrol means for controlling a quantization step of said quantization means in accordance with a remaining data quantity of said buffer memory.
- 7. An apparatus according to claim 5, further comprising:detection means for detecting an activity of the image signal input by said input means; and control means for controlling a quantization step of said quantization means in accordance with the activity detected by said detection means.
- 8. A coding apparatus comprising:a) block forming means for forming a block of sample values of an input signal; b) coding means having a first coding mode in which the block of the input signal is coded by using data representative of differences between prediction values and the sample values of the block, and a second coding mode in which the block of the input signal is coded without using data representative of differences, said coding means for selecting the coding mode on a unit of a predetermined data amount of the image signal and forcibly selecting the first coding mode at first predetermined time intervals so that the second coding mode is prevented from being executed continuously during each first predetermined time interval; and c) change means for changing the length of each first predetermined time interval according to the input signal to cause said coding means to select the first coding mode at second predetermined time intervals.
- 9. An apparatus according to claim 8, further comprising:comparing means for comparing a data quantity of the data representative of a difference with a data quantity of data representative of the sample values, wherein said coding means selects one from among the coding modes in accordance with a comparison result of said comparing means.
- 10. An apparatus according to claim 8, further comprisinga buffer memory for temporarily storing the coded data to be read out at a predetermined transmission rate.
- 11. An apparatus according to claim 10, whereinsaid coding means includes quantization means for quantizing the image signal input by said input means.
- 12. An apparatus according to claim 11, further comprisingcontrol means for controlling a quantization step of said quantization means in accordance with a data occupation quantity of said buffer memory.
- 13. An apparatus according to claim 8, wherein said changing means changes the length of each first predetermined time interval according to a quantity of coded data of the input signal.
- 14. An apparatus according to claim 13, further comprisingdetection means for detecting an activity of the image signal input by said input means, so that the quantity of coded data generated is determined by the activity detected by said detection means.
- 15. A coding apparatus comprising:a) input means for inputting an image signal; b) detection means for detecting an activity of the image signal input by said input means; c) coding means for coding the image signal input by said input means, said coding means for adaptively executing a first coding mode for performing intra-picture coding and a second coding mode for performing inter-picture coding, said coding means selecting the coding mode on a unit of a predetermined data amount of the image signal and forcibly selecting the first coding mode at first predetermined time intervals so that the second coding mode is prevented from being executed continuously during each first predetermined time interval; and d) change means for changing the length of each first predetermined time interval according to the activity detected by said detection means to cause said coding means to select the first coding mode at second predetermined time intervals.
- 16. An apparatus according to claim 15, whereinthe activity is data representative of a correlation of an image.
- 17. An apparatus according to claim 15, further comprising:comparing means for comparing a data quantity of the data representative of a difference with a data quantity of data representing the same values, wherein said coding means selects one from among the coding modes in accordance with a comparison result of said comparing means.
- 18. An apparatus according to claim 15, further comprisinga buffer memory for temporarily storing the coded data to be read out at a predetermined transmission rate.
- 19. An apparatus according to claim 18, whereinsaid coding means includes quantization means for quantizing the image signal input by said input means.
- 20. An apparatus according to claim 19, further comprisingcontrol means for controlling a quantization step of said quantization means in accordance with a data occupation quantity of said buffer memory.
- 21. A coding method comprising the steps of:a) inputting an image signal; b) coding the image signal input by said input step, said coding step adaptively executing a first coding mode for performing intra-picture coding and a second coding mode for performing inter-picture coding, and said coding step selecting the coding mode on a unit of a predetermined data amount of the image signal and forcibly selecting the first coding mode at first predetermined time intervals so that the second coding mode is prevented from being executed continuously during each first predetermined time interval; and c) changing the length of each first predetermined time interval to cause said coding step to select the first coding mode at second predetermined time intervals.
- 22. A coding method comprising the steps of:a) forming a block of sample values of an input signal; b) executing a first coding mode on which the block of the input signal is coded by using data representative of differences between prediction values and the sample values of the block, and executing a second coding mode in which the block of the input signal is coded without using data representative of differences, said executing step selecting the coding mode on a unit of a predetermined data amount of the image signal and forcibly selecting the first coding mode at first predetermined time intervals so that the second coding mode is prevented from being executed continuously during each first predetermined time interval; and c) changing the length of the first predetermined time interval according to the input signal to cause said executing step to select the first coding mode at second predetermined time intervals.
- 23. A coding method comprising the steps of:a) inputting an image signal; b) detecting an activity of the image signal input by said input step; c) coding the image signal input by said input step, said coding step adaptively executing a first coding mode for performing intra-picture coding and a second coding mode for performing inter-picture coding, said coding step including a step of selecting the coding mode on a unit of a predetermined data amount of the image signal and forcibly selecting the first coding mode at predetermined time intervals so that the second coding mode is prevented from being executed continuously during each first predetermined time interval; and d) changing the length of each first predetermined time interval according to the activity detected in said detecting step to cause said selecting step to select the first coding mode at second predetermined time intervals.
Priority Claims (1)
Number |
Date |
Country |
Kind |
6-114165 |
Apr 1994 |
JP |
|
Parent Case Info
This application is a continuation of application Ser. No. 08/426,797 filed Apr. 24, 1995, now abandoned.
US Referenced Citations (7)
Continuations (1)
|
Number |
Date |
Country |
Parent |
08/426797 |
Apr 1995 |
US |
Child |
08/781066 |
|
US |